Due to the COVID-19 outbreak, academic institutions across the globe have been forced to move to online learning environments. It has been particularly challenging for the experimental sciences to develop and deliver authentic lab-based experiences. Some of the strategies that have been adopted for first-year physics labs include: providing a video demonstration and supplying data for students to analyze, using online simulations, having students construct simple apparatuses using commonly available materials, collecting data with the aid of a smartphone, and, when dealing with smaller class sizes, providing a custom lab kit to each student. Many institutions have chosen to adopt a blend of the various strategies.
